Explore a world of opportunity in Application Development - Mainframe jobs, a critical and enduring field where professionals build, maintain, and modernize the powerful backend systems that drive the world's largest enterprises. Mainframe application developers are the custodians of core business logic, working on robust, secure, and high-volume transaction processing systems for industries like finance, insurance, and government. These roles are not about legacy upkeep alone; they are at the forefront of integrating decades of reliable business processes with modern cloud services and APIs, creating a hybrid IT environment that leverages the best of both old and new technologies. Professionals in mainframe application development jobs are typically responsible for the entire application lifecycle. This includes analyzing user requirements to design and code new software features, as well as maintaining and enhancing existing systems. A typical day might involve writing and debugging code in core mainframe languages, conducting unit and integration testing, and performing system analysis to identify necessary enhancements or resolve complex issues. They are also responsible for identifying and mitigating security vulnerabilities to ensure the integrity of sensitive data. As developers progress, they often consult with other technology groups and business stakeholders to recommend programming solutions and may eventually mentor junior analysts, sharing deep institutional and technical knowledge. The technical skill set for these positions is specialized and highly valued. Core programming proficiency is essential, primarily in COBOL, along with JCL (Job Control Language) for batch processing and CICS for transaction management. Knowledge of DB2 for database operations and VSAM for file handling is also fundamental. Beyond these core technologies, familiarity with modern tools like Ab Initio for data integration or version control systems is increasingly common. Crucially, soft skills are paramount. Success in mainframe jobs requires strong analytical and problem-solving abilities to dissect complex issues, excellent written and verbal communication to interact with teams and document systems, and the capacity to work under pressure while managing deadlines. Typical requirements for entering this field often include a bachelor's degree in computer science, information technology, or a related field, although equivalent experience is frequently valued. Career paths are well-defined, ranging from entry-level programmer analysts who work under guidance, to intermediate roles with more autonomy and complex problem-solving, and up to senior and management positions where individuals lead teams, manage budgets, and set technical strategy.
